Exploring eMachines Laptop Construction and Screen Evaluation Methods
eMachines laptops emphasize value and mobility with compact frames that facilitate easy transport yet make displays susceptible to damage from frequent movement and impacts. These units generally employ LED-illuminated LCD screens using TN panels for rapid refresh rates, linked by narrow flex cables to the mainboard. In series like the E510 or D525, the articulated hinges may wear down gradually, straining linkages and causing visual anomalies.
Our evaluation begins with an external examination, progressing to activation checks that assess illumination performance and data transmission quality. Employing precision instruments, we verify the converter for consistent power output and scrutinize wiring for damage or kinks. This detailed investigation reveals underlying problems past obvious harm, guaranteeing enduring performance for your eMachines in Niagara's diverse environments.
Typical Indicators and Weak Areas in eMachines Displays
- Shattered panels from impacts, prevalent on trips from Niagara Falls to Welland, which blur images and threaten inner circuits.
- Intermittent flashing from unsecured display wires, caused by constant cover movements in routine operations.
- Total darkness from defective converters, where the machine operates but the display remains unlit.
- Tint variations or inactive pixels from compression on the LCD layers, typical in eMachines' thin profiles.
- Horizontal streaks pointing to damaged row controllers in the display grid, stemming from wear or fluid exposure.
- Faded brightness from degraded fluorescent backlights in legacy versions, impairing view in intense Niagara daylight.

Essential Advice to Protect Your eMachines Laptop Display in Niagara
To maintain your eMachines screen resilient against Niagara's dampness and mobility requirements, heed these professional suggestions. These economical laptops excel with forward-thinking maintenance customized to regional hurdles.
- Brace the chassis during lid lift to lessen joint tug on display wires.
- Employ cushioned carriers for journeys, particularly on rough paths from Niagara Falls to Thorold.
- Wipe with soft fabrics solely, bypassing agents that abrade surfaces.
- Modulate intensity adaptively to ease illumination wear in fluctuating illumination, such as Welland overcast.
- Arrange semi-annual inspections at JTG to detect terminal degradation promptly.
- Avoid intense warmth, frequent in enclosed St. Catharines areas, which bends materials.
- Refresh video software periodically for enhanced transmission management and reduced distortions.
- Incorporate a ventilation base for extended activities to halt sealant breakdowns from heat.
- Transport via the underside, avoiding the display, to prevent compression marks.
